## Thumbnail Queue: Release Notes for You

Welcome aboard! The Pixelsift thumbnail generation queue is the thing everyone forgets about until images stop rendering. Releases are low-drama: merge to `stable`, let the Crankshaft pipeline do its thing, and watch the canary dashboard for ten minutes. One gotcha — the worker image must be signed before the orchestrator will pull it, or you'll get a wall of `unverified manifest` errors at 2 a.m. (ask Dena from the Oatfield team how she knows). The key you'll sign with is this one:

signing key of tawig-yagep = bky4_HQEP

Quarterly Planning Note — Divestiture of the Coastal Tooling Unit

For the finance team: the sale of the Coastal Tooling unit to Pellmark Industries remains on track for close in Q3. Please finalize the carve-out balance sheet, reconcile intercompany positions, and prepare the working-capital adjustment schedule by month-end. Audit support requests should be prioritized. For planning purposes, note the following sensitive item:

internal memo for hawef-kahif: The finance team signed off on a budget of $25.9 million for Project Sorox. The renewal with Pelokek Logistics closes at $51.7 million a year, 52 percent below the last contract.

## Changelog: timezone defaults in report exports

Vellamark exports previously assumed server-local time, causing off-by-a-day rows for customers east of the render cluster. Exports now default to the tenant's configured timezone, falling back to UTC. No action needed for tenants with explicit settings. The new behavior is controlled by the following configuration values:

settings of kagup-tagug:
ULAIX_HOST=ulaix.zemvarsys.internal
ULAIX_PORT=8000

Hey release folks — the Trailnote offline mode branch is ready for review. Surveys now queue locally and sync when signal returns; conflict handling is last-write-wins for now, flagged in the UI. Aldra ran it through the canyon test route with zero drops. The candidate build I tested is identified below.

build token for kagaf-hahof: htk14_9d3d4d26d7d8de